Most Bronson fans will fudge their way through his mid to late 80's flicks in search of more classic Bronson before finding this lost classic. Save your time and bucks by going straight to this classic crime thriller. See Bronson create the screen persona that would stay with him the rest of his long career. Bronson shines as the notorious and tough as nails Machine Gun Kelly. He plays a ruthless and mean spirited criminal with no love for anyone and a great fear of death. Great direction and pacing, great action and stylistic photography make for an enjoyable 80 minute diversion into the world of crime in early America. I'm not sure how accurate this was to the real life of Machine Gun, but Bronson brings to life his character in a way that grabbed the attention of a young Hollywood. If you love the tough guy Bronson and are trying to add to your collection, skip most of his later films (Assasination, 10 to Midnight, Kinjite, Messenger...)and go straight for Machine Gun Kelly. I promise you'll get the mean mutha' Bronson that you're looking for!! At this price, how can ya miss? Time to put this on DVD.....

4.0 out of 5 stars Bronson Is George "machine gun" Kelly, April 27, 2009
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Machine Gun Kelly [VHS] (VHS Tape)
Charles Bronson in his first starring role as George "machine gun" Kelly, a film close to reality of the notorious gangster of the prohibition era and Bronson is superb in the role, with the surrounding cast right up to par. The film starts out with the perfect bank heist, perfectly drawn out like a map until one member of the gang (Morey Amsterdam) decides to get greedy and "machine gun" seeks out revenge, the next bank job is not as smooth when Kelly forgets to consume a shot of courage, then Kelly's girlfriend trys to convince the gangster to forget about his compulsive fear of cowardness. The real George Kelly was convicted and sent up for kidnapping, sentenced for life, and died in prison after serving twenty one years, nicknamed "pop gun" Kelly, from fellow inmates for being the perfect model prisoner and Kelly apparently not as tough as his reputation. MACHINE GUN KELLY, 1958, almost the perfect gangster film and a must for Bronson collectors, excellent VHS video transfer.
